目前想把写在*.vue文件中的style里的样式提取到一个文件中,在网上查了,但是基本上没有起到作用。
2 回答
鸿蒙传说
TA贡献1865条经验 获得超7个赞
// webpack.config.js
var ExtractTextPlugin = require("extract-text-webpack-plugin")
module.exports = {
module: {
rules: [
{
test: /\.vue$/,
loader: 'vue-loader',
options: {
extractCSS: true
}
}
]
},
plugins: [
new ExtractTextPlugin("style.css")
]
}
通过这个方式可以将*.vue中的样式提取到指定路径,我没有成功是因为vue-loader的版本问题
慕沐林林
TA贡献2016条经验 获得超9个赞
假设在src的assets的目录下有一个style文件夹,里面放一个test.css文件,这样在.vue文件中引入方式为:
<style>
@import '~@/assets/style/test.css'
</style>
添加回答
举报
0/150
提交
取消
